Abstract

This review shows a strong link between employee mental health and well-being, and organizational success. Positive mental health boosts well-being, leading to better organizational outcomes like productivity and retention. Supportive work environments, including work-life balance and social support, are crucial. Interventions improving mental health and well-being directly correlate with better organizational performance (e.g., increased productivity, lower healthcare costs). Investing in employee well-being provides a strong return on investment. Future research should focus on longitudinal studies, contextual factors, diversity and inclusion, and technological interventions. A holistic approach to supporting both mental health and well-being fosters a thriving workforce and sustainable organizational success.
